** The home security market for residents of Rose, Oklahoma, is characterized by a reliance on regional providers from nearby commercial hubs like Pryor, Claremore, and Tulsa. There are no dedicated security companies physically located within the town of Rose itself. The competition level is moderate, with a mix of national giants (like ADT through authorized dealers) and strong, reputable local companies vying for customers in the rural and suburban communities of Mayes County. The average quality of service is high, as local and regional companies compete on personalized customer service and technical expertise. Typical pricing is competitive, with basic monitored alarm systems starting around $30-$50 per month, plus the cost of equipment (which can range from a few hundred to several thousand dollars depending on the complexity of the system, including cameras, smart locks, and sensors). Customers in this area highly value reliability, local responsiveness for maintenance and repairs, and the integration of modern technology like security cameras and smart home controls.

In the Rose area, a basic professionally installed system with 24/7 monitoring typically starts between $500-$800 for equipment and installation, with monthly monitoring fees ranging from $30 to $60. Local factors like the size of your property and the need for cellular backup (important in rural areas where internet can be less reliable) can influence the final price. It's wise to get quotes from several providers, as competition in Delaware County and Northeast Oklahoma can lead to promotional deals, especially for new customers.
Oklahoma's tornado season and frequent severe thunderstorms make power and communication backup critical. You should prioritize systems with a long-lasting battery backup and cellular monitoring, as landlines and internet can fail during storms. Furthermore, consider integrating environmental sensors like water leak detectors for heavy rains and, if applicable, a storm shelter sensor or panic button to alert monitoring centers of your location during a weather emergency.
The Town of Rose does not have a specific ordinance requiring a permit for standard home security alarm installation. However, Oklahoma state law and most local jurisdictions, including nearby larger towns, have false alarm ordinances. You may be fined for excessive false alarms, so it's crucial to ensure proper system training and maintenance. Always verify with your specific provider about any county-level requirements for alarm system registration.
A local provider based in Northeast Oklahoma often offers more personalized service, understands the specific challenges of rural properties in areas like Rose, and may provide faster in-person response times for service. National companies typically have broader technology options and name recognition. Key questions to ask any provider are their average local emergency response time, how they handle cellular backup during outages, and if they service your specific, potentially remote, address.
For most homes in rural Rose, modern wireless systems are often the more practical and effective choice. They are easier and less expensive to install in existing structures, are not reliant on your home's internal wiring, and use cellular signals that remain operational even if phone lines are down. Hardwired systems can be more reliable long-term but are best suited for new construction due to the invasive installation process required in older homes.
